Physical Properties
- Acentric factor0.13
- Critical pressure (bar)35.6
- Critical temperature (°C)128.85
- Critical volume (m³/kmol)0.258
- Dipole moment0.75
- Melting temperature (°C)-150
- Normal boiling temperature (°C)-20
